Wood Burning Stove Sale
Wood stoves are used to heat homes and operate without the power grid. They provide a warm and inviting atmosphere and reduce heating costs by reducing dependency on fossil fuels.
It is important to properly the size of a wood stove in order to avoid excessive smoke levels within the home. Smoke from wood is particularly dangerous to children, older adults and those suffering from lung disease.
Size
When looking for a wood stove, it's important to find the correct size. Too small of a stove won't produce enough heat to keep your house warm. On the other hand, a large stove will generate more heat than it needs and can increase your energy costs. To get the best results, consult an expert to assess your home and choose the best wood stove.
You should also consider the type of wood that you'll use to build your stove. The type of wood and its moisture content will influence how well it burns. Dry, well-seasoned firewood will provide the best results. It should be stored and stacked in a well-ventilated area for at least a couple of months prior to when you begin using it.
Modern wood stoves are designed to minimize emissions. They have several features that help them achieve this goal. For instance, they come with a metal channel that produces secondary heat and feeds it into the flames above them. This hot air provides the necessary oxygen to ensure complete combustion, while reducing the amount of harmful gases and particulates. The stoves also come with a built-in damper that allows you to control how much air is drawn into and out of the fire.

Installation
Wood stoves can bring a cozy, warm feeling to any space in the home. They're a great alternative to electric furnaces. They provide style and charm to homes, and the addition of wood stoves can help you relax with a good book or chatting with friends over a glass of wine much more enjoyable. Stoves can be found in various styles sizes, shapes, and sizes. They are also more efficient and easy to use than before.
Whether you choose to install an all-new wood burning stove in your living room, bedroom, kitchen or other area of your home there are some things to think about prior to purchasing. You need to first determine the type of wood you want to burn. Each type of wood has its own characteristics which will influence the way it burns. For example, hardwoods are usually slightly more expensive than softwoods however, they burn longer and produce more heat.
Once you've decided on the kind of wood you want it is time to decide the size of the stove you'll need. This can be a bit complicated, but it is possible to determine the right size by consulting a knowledgeable stove manufacturer or dealer. It is also recommended to check local codes for building to ensure that your stove is designed for the space you have.
In addition to making sure that your stove is the right size, you'll need prepare the area where it will be installed. This includes ensuring that there is enough space between fire-prone surfaces like furniture, floors, and, drywall or paneling. There are guidelines for safe distances by consulting the manufacturer of your stove, or the National Fire Protection Association's recommended clearances.
Before you begin using your stove, make sure to have it checked and cleaned by a chimney sweep. This is a crucial step to avoid expensive and dangerous chimney and flue issues. It will also keep your stove and chimney functioning efficiently. You should also install a carbon monoxide detector in your room in which your wood stove is, to ensure that you and your family are safe from this harmful gas.
